Personalization Questions

1) When personalization is enabled, the matrix visual is limited to a maximum of 100 columns. Is there any way around that? Is there a way to filter within the matrix (without having to add an extra slicer?)

 

2) Is there any any way to pin the Personalize Box so it doesn't go away?

1) When personalization is enabled, the matrix visual is limited to a maximum of 100 columns. Is there any way around that? Is there a way to filter within the matrix (without having to add an extra slicer?)

The maximum number of columns in a matrix is 100, and the best way to do this is to use slicers for dynamic filtering, or you can create measures and use relevant filter functions in the measure to filter, such as the filter() function, you can refer to the following link.

2) Is there any any way to pin the Personalize Box so it doesn't go away?

After testing, the box cannot be pinned, when you need to personalize the visual, click the icon, it will appear, by default, it will be hidden.
